Output d3112ede8ea6d49484dbb9733265023c7f264fc3c56d7def205adcf2bfacb88c:62

value
96881616
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5edf66cf124f7b8ab8769041ea819ff5bed1cabf OP_EQUAL
address
MGYoNgEpzdiJJvVAnWh3BDdtXmadqUoK3e
transaction
d3112ede8ea6d49484dbb9733265023c7f264fc3c56d7def205adcf2bfacb88c
spent
true